Mary Joan "Joanne" Shafer's Obituary
Big Rapids -Mary Joan "Joanne" Shafer, 85, of Big Rapids, passed away Monday, June 4, 2018, after a lengthy illness, surrounded by her loving family.
She was born March 18, 1933 in Big Rapids, the daughter of Dominic and Ann (Byrnes) Doyle. Joanne attended grade school at St. Mary Catholic School, and graduated from Big Rapids High School in 1951. Following her graduation, Joanne started working in the office of Wolverine World Wide, retiring in 1989 after 38 years of service.
Joanne was the "Very Favorite Aunt" to all her nieces and nephews. She never missed a birthday, sending a card with a stick of gum "Juicy Fruit", "Big Red", or "Teaberry" enclosed. She also sent other birthday, get well, wedding, or just hello cards to friends. Joanne loved to cook and bake, and made numerous goodies for the church bake sale.
On April 22, 1972, she married Earl "Bud" Shafer, Jr., at St. Mary Church, and he preceded her in death on March 20 of this year.
